The annual Mince Pie event from CycleWight is going from strength to strength, last year saw 30 people attending and this year CycleWight are hoping for more.
What better recomendation than a recent plug in the Daily Telegraph as a free activity to do during the Christmas break.
Top 20 free things to do this Christmas
Come and join us as it is obviously the thing to do!. Easy family bike ride around the surrounding countryside. Mince pies and mulled wine to follow. Children Under 16 must be accompanied. This is part of council’s ‘Winter Walks and activities programme’ so if you wish to take part officially, helmets will have to be worn.
Meet on Sat 27th Dec 11.00am at Alverstone Village Hall, Donations for refreshments. for more info tel: 520529

CycleWight is the Island’s Cycling campaign group, formed in 1993. Who are working hard to promote improved cycling facilities on the Island for the benefit of residents and visitors. With much quiet countryside, miles of cycleroutes, bridleways and spectacular coastline the Island is ideal for exploring by bike.
